Tender Summary

Objectives

The primary objective of this tender is to appoint a service provider for fire and invasive species control in Pinetown and Sherwood areas. The aim is to effectively manage and mitigate fire risks and invasive plant species, ensuring safety, environmental protection, and compliance with relevant legislation.

Scope

The scope of the project includes:

  • Fire control and prevention activities within designated areas of Pinetown and Sherwood.
  • Invasive species management, including identification, removal, and control measures.
  • Implementation of firebreaks to prevent the spread of fire to residential and other properties.
  • Adherence to occupational health and safety standards during all activities.

Technical Requirements

The technical requirements for the service provider include:

  • Compliance with the Occupational Health and Safety Act No. 85 of 1993 and related regulations.
  • Preparation of a health and safety file for approval by the Occupational Health and Safety Unit.
  • Conducting activity risk assessments and developing written safe working procedures.
  • Training employees on risk assessments and safe working procedures.
  • Ensuring vehicles are in good working condition and suitable for the tasks.
  • Ensuring all employees have valid medical certificates of fitness.
  • Provision and mandatory use of appropriate Personal Protective Equipment (PPE).
  • Implementing safety precautions when working at heights, such as ladder safety.
  • Installing firebreaks to prevent fire spread.
  • Familiarity with hazards related to fire and invasive species control.
  • Registration and good standing with the Compensation for Occupational Injuries and Diseases Commissioner.
  • Having adequate insurance coverage for fire-related damages and property protection.

Skills Requirements

The skills required from the service provider include:

  • Knowledge of fire management and invasive species control techniques.
  • Ability to conduct risk assessments and develop safe work procedures.
  • Competence in operating relevant equipment and vehicles safely.
  • Training personnel in safety protocols and hazard awareness.
  • Understanding of occupational health and safety legislation and compliance requirements.
  • Effective communication skills to coordinate with the municipality and team members.
